Luna Innovations, an advanced optical technology company based in Roanoke, Virginia, specializes in fiber optic testing and sensing solutions, employing 337 people since its IPO in 2006. Its Lightwave segment develops optical measurement technologies for telecommunications and various industries.
Based on our analysis, Luna Innovations (LUNA) has received an undervalued rating of 4 out of 5 stars from Cashu, supported by several strong financial ratios that indicate its stability and potential for growth.
Luna's Price-to-Book (PB) ratio stands at 3.10, slightly below the sector average of 3.15. A lower PB ratio often suggests that a company is undervalued relative to its assets. This indicates that investors may be underestimating Luna's asset base compared to its peers.
More notably, Luna Innovations boasts a net profit margin of 8.49%, significantly outperforming the sector's negative margin of -18.56%. This positive margin highlights Luna's ability to convert sales into actual profit, reflecting effective cost management and operational efficiency.
Additionally, the company's Return on Equity (ROE) ratio is 9.96%, compared to the sector's -24.93%. A positive ROE indicates that Luna is effectively utilizing shareholders' equity to generate profits, showcasing strong financial health and management effectiveness.
Furthermore, Luna's Return on Assets (ROA) ratio is 6.16%, whereas the sector average is -13.93%. This ratio indicates that Luna is efficient in using its assets to generate earnings, reinforcing its operational competence.
Overall, Luna Innovations demonstrates solid financial performance across key metrics, suggesting it may be undervalued in the market.
